Well the day has come, my first 3 home born and reared boars are off tomorrow. A little later than I planned but getting a slot booked for them has been a devil!
Think I've sorted everything, SFS sorted my slap marker in record time and despite the kids sleeping through the courier he came back this afternoon as i rang amd told them it was urgent. What fantastic service is that! Food chain form filled in movement licence completed, piggies loaded, slap marked and sleeping soundly in the trailer ( got to be there by 6:30 am so didn't want the stress for them or us tomorrow) oh and freezers and fridge sorted thanks to hairyhogs. (thanks again Jason, top bloke).
So have to say it is with pride actually, that our fine animals will fulfill the purpose for which they were bred and I'm really looking forward to my first home produced pork.
If anyone thinks I've forgotten anything shout now!
